Dog dies in Cedar Rapids mobile home fire
Jeff Raasch
Jul. 5, 2010 8:10 am
Fire caused extensive damage and killed a dog in a mobile home fire early Monday.
Firefighters were called to 381 Lesley Ln. NE around 6:15 a.m. Acting Battalion Chief Dan Ripley said no one was home when the fire broke out.
Crews brought the fire under control, but not before it burned through an exterior wall. They had to rip out part of the ceiling to see if the fire had spread.
“We don't want (the effort) to be in vain,” Capt. Mike Mulherin said.
Mulherin said the people who live in the mobile home would be displaced. The American Red Cross was called to provide assistance.
Investigators were working to determine what caused the blaze.
